3D for iPhone Apps with Blender and SIO2: Your Guide to by Tony Mullen

By Tony Mullen

When you have ever attempted to write down a online game with simply undeniable openGL ES then you definately be aware of that is not tips to enhance a full-fledged iPhone 3D online game. the trail specified by this publication is how one can move.

The ebook begins with an easy advent to OpenGL ES to demonstrate my element above. bankruptcy 2 is an creation to SIO2 programming. bankruptcy three and four discover the Blender international and combine the scene created in Blender into iPhone SDK through SIO2. by way of bankruptcy four, we now have the "World" spinning at the iPhone machine, in 3D (a depraved twist at the vintage "Hello global" software, enjoyed it). you furthermore may get a pleasant pat at the again from the writer for making it to date! The bankruptcy on 'Picking and textual content' is great. the remainder of the chapters does a pleasant activity of completing the advent to all components of a 3D game.

There are a few error too within the ebook - specially in bankruptcy three - the place we opt for the sting loop - the best way defined in bankruptcy didn't paintings for me, yet relating the Appendix on Blender helped. it's also really easy to wander off in the entire intricacies of Blender and C/C++, yet with a bit of of exploring it is easy to come again on course - endurance will pay off. I want the writer had extra an Appendix on complex C/C++ for the good points utilized in the publication.

Show description

Read Online or Download 3D for iPhone Apps with Blender and SIO2: Your Guide to Creating 3D Games and More with Open-Source Software PDF

Similar design & graphics books

iPhoto 6: The Missing Manual

Should you used iPhoto while it first got here out, you are going to bear in mind how it slowed to a move slowly when you loaded it with approximately 2,000 pictures. examine that to this year's version: iPhoto 6 can deal with as many as 250,000 photos and also have the ability to run a bunch of suped-up gains. Its new software program engine allows you to make adjustments with a drag & drop enhancing software, locate photographs with a powerful seek characteristic, and manage pictures with no affecting the originals on your grasp library.

Adobe Illustrator CS2 Official JavaScript Reference

Are you an artistic expert? Do you spend an excessive amount of time doing repetitive creation projects corresponding to putting and exchanging photos, resizing them, dragging them from one record to a different, and getting ready photographs for printing rather than being inventive? Do you employ Adobe Illustrator CS2 and feature a few adventure with scripting?

Adobe Creative Suite 4 Design Premium Classroom in a Book

This thorough, self-paced consultant to Adobe inventive Suite four is perfect for clients who are looking to study the most important gains of Adobe's stellar number of specialist layout instruments. Readers are first given a quick application evaluate of the layout Suite that highlights universal gains and contains a part on cross-media workflows.

Windows Presentation Foundation 4.5 Cookbook

Over eighty recipes to successfully and successfully increase wealthy home windows purchaser purposes at the home windows platform jam-packed with illustrations, diagrams, and information with transparent step by step directions and genuine global examples achieve a powerful origin of WPF beneficial properties and styles Leverage the MVVM trend to construct decoupled, maintainable apps intimately home windows Presentation beginning (WPF) presents builders with a unified programming version for development wealthy home windows shrewdpermanent purchaser consumer reports that contain UI, media, and files.

Extra info for 3D for iPhone Apps with Blender and SIO2: Your Guide to Creating 3D Games and More with Open-Source Software

Sample text

Build and run your project. If you are building on the simulator, you can test the function by clicking your mouse on the simulator’s screen. 6. If you’re building to your device, then touching the screen will have the same effect. Experiment with touching different places on the screen and note what the corresponding x and y values are. Try tapping quickly and seeing how the tap count changes. Tap down and hold for a while before lifting your finger to see the difference between tap-down and tap-up events.

6 A UV sphere 34 ■ Chapter 3 : Saying Hello to the Blender/SIO2 /iPhone World lighting effects by using static textures, as you will do in other tutorials later in this book. 5. 7, select Set Smooth, and then add a material by clicking New in the Material button panel. This material will hold the image texture for the object. 8 Adding a texture to the material 6. 8, by clicking Add New. Hello 3D World! Creating Your World in Blender 7. In the MA field in the Links And Pipeline panel of the Material buttons area, rename the material MatEarth.

The matrix stack enables you to set a point in the sequence of transformations, add new transformations, and then jump back to the previous point. This is done by pushing the matrix onto a stack, adding transformations, doing what you want to do with them, and then popping the matrix stack to return to the previous state of transformations. The data structure of a stack is something like a PEZ candy dispenser if you were to load it piece by piece through the character’s mouth—as you push more objects onto the stack, the first objects you pushed on are pushed further and further down the stack.

Download PDF sample

Rated 4.51 of 5 – based on 38 votes